#14d1d2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#14d1d2 is composed of 7.8% red, 82%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 90.5% cyan, 0.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 180.3 degrees, a saturation of 82.6% and a lightness of 45.1%. #14d1d2 color hex could be obtained by blending #28ffff with #00a3a5. Closest websafe color is: #00cccc.

Shades and Tints of #14d1d2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010d0d is the darkest color, while #faff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#14d1d2
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6c797a is the less saturated color, while #02e3e4 is the most saturated one.
